How much does a Mental Health Worker make in Philadelphia, PA?
A Mental Health Worker in Philadelphia, PA, can earn a solid income. The average yearly salary sits around $38,263. This offers job seekers a glimpse into the financial rewards of this career choice. Most workers can expect to fall within a range of salaries.
To offer more detail, here is a breakdown of the income distribution:
- 26.72% of workers earn around $34,000.
- 23.75% earn about $35,173.
- 2.97% earn close to $36,345.
- 11.88% earn approximately $39,864.
- 14.84% earn roughly $41,036.
- 2.97% earn near $42,209.
- 5.94% earn around $43,382.
- 0.00% earn around $37,518, $38,691, $44,555, and $45,727.
- 5.94% earn about $46,900.
